07th May 2001
Upper Beeding 7:0 Midhurst
Upper Beeding brought the curtain down on an exceptional season with
a seven
nil drubbing of fourth placed Midhurst on Monday afternoon, scoring
their
one hundredth goal, in all competitions, in the process.
Goalkeeper Scott Redfern set a new Upper Beeding record, conceding just
16
times in twenty two league appearances as the Premier Division Champions
secured their twenty fifth win in a row.
Gary Salters' through ball found Stuart Barry on fourteen minutes and
the
diminutive striker drew Alex Wadey before setting up strike partner
Lee
Strange for the easiest of chances.
Strange returned the compliment on thirty two minutes as he set up Barry
to
rifle home from the edge of the box.
Within four minutes, as Midhurst wilted, Mat Doo burst down the left
and
pulled the ball back for Strange to smash in his second.
Two minutes later and it was 4-0. Mark Salter fed David Smith forty
yards
out and the sparkling mid fielder did the rest, ghosting past three
challenges, around Wadey to stoke the ball into an empty net.
Wadey saved Midhurst from further first half punishment with superlative
saves from Doo and Strange.
After the break it was more of the same. Midhurst trying desperately
to stem
the onrushing Beeding tide of possession.
It was more than comfortable for Mick Barrys' boys as Glyn Edmonds set
Doo
away to square for Barry junior to pop in his second on sixty minutes
and
when Barry was hauled down by Wadey five minutes later, Gary "the Z
man"
Salter stepped forward to send the third goalkeeper in a row in the
opposite
direction to his spot kick.
It was unfortunate that Wadey, by far Midhurst most accomplished player,
was
at fault for Beedings seventh in the dying minutes.
Mark "Pumpkin" Salters' speculative ball through the middle was completely
missed by the Midhurst custodian and Doo was on hand to notch his fifteenth
of the season.
